    It's been a while since I've had a decent notebook so I am not sure whether to expect this or not.

    My SZ1VP (SZ180) seems to take ages to load applications. For example from clicking the Notepad icon I have placed on my desktop to notepad actually launching is in the region of 40+ seconds.

    Launching Photoshop CS2 takes 1-2 minutes.

    Quitting these apps and relaunching them is pretty much instantaneous (I assume this is because they have been cached). But after a system restart it takes ages for them to load again.

    Is this normal behaviour? I know the HDD is 6400rpm but nearly a minute to launch notepad seems a bit silly.

    After start up, and everything has settled down open task manager and see what your PF usage is under performance , it should be no more than 250mb give or take abit, if it is go to the process tab and reorder then from most to least and google check which ones are using the most, sounds like you either have a virus or a rogue programme, if its just a programme select it and end process then retry loading a app, if that sorts it unistall what it was and reinstall, if its a virus (obviuosly) do everything to kill it.

    notepad should open pretty much instantly regardless of what youve got running, and photoshop on my s460 opens in about 12 secs from cold (just to give you a sort of idea what you should be getting)

    Defragging a practically brand new notebook hard drive will do zilch. Even a many, many year old drive will only see a few percentage points of improvement.

    Notepad should come up instantly. I just tried loading CorelDraw 12 and it took 14 seconds. Maybe slightly slower than my desktop.

    I'm wondering if you have something hung in the background, or if the drive is somehow in some sort of non-DMA compatibility mode, whether your g-sensor is kicking in all the time... or what really, since this is FAR from normal.
